UPDATE 1/12 10:30AM: Burleigh County Officials say that Patrick Johnson was arrested West of Mandan on Jan. 11 without incident.

ORIGINAL STORY (from Jan. 9 at 1:18pm):

According to the Burleigh County Sheriff's Department, on Jan. 6 deputies went to 9205 Island Road for a welfare check.

A man, Patrick Johnson, who is 36 years old identified himself. Deputies learned that the man had outstanding warrants in Cass County due to a DUI, theft, and a failure to appear.

Johnson led police on a foot pursuit before eventually entering into a white 2013 Legacy Subaru. Johnson hit into one Deputy's vehicle and eventually into another Deputy who was trying to set up spike strips.

Once Johnson entered the city limits of Bismarck, the chase was terminated for safety concerns. He was last seen driving southbound on North Washington Street.

The 2013 Legacy Subaru was apparently not his vehicle. It has the license plate number 189 AOK.
